      A cylindrical drum has internal radius 2 m and height

      3.5 m. Find its volume. Take π = 22/7.
      A 18 m³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      B 25 m³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      C 44 m³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      D 32 m³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

      Solution

      Volume = πr²h = (22/7) × 2² × 3.5 = (22/7) × 4 × 3.5 3.5 = 7/2 → Volume = (22/7) × 4 × (7/2) = 22 × 2 = 44 m³
